Amazon’s Audible to turn all 7 Harry Potter books into full-cast audio productions with over 100 actors

The upcoming project will premiere on Amazon Audible in late 2025

New audio productions of all seven of JK Rowling’s Harry Potter books involving over 100 voice actors will premiere on Amazon’s Audible in late 2025, the audiobook and podcast streamer announced on Thursday.

“Attention listeners! A brand-new, full-cast audio performance of #HarryPotter awaits you in late 2025. Prepare for a journey through the mystical world of Hogwarts with an enchanting original score and sound design for an unforgettable experience,” Audible announced on X alongside a teaser video.

The teaser begins with a character chanting the spell “Lumos”, which is used to light up a dark setting. In the next scene, we are transported to a recording studio where volume buttons and mixers are switched on. Subsequently, we are treated to lines spoken by wandmaker Ollivander to Harry, Hermione upon meeting Harry for the first time and Hagrid to Harry about how his life would be at Hogwarts.

The full-cast audio performances will “sit alongside and complement the iconic single-voice English language recordings by Jim Dale and Stephen Fry,” Audible said in a statement. However, it is not clear whether the original cast of the Harry Potter film series, including Daniel Radcliffe, Emma Watson and Rupert Grint, will lend their voices to their characters in the audio drama.

Audiobooks of each of the seven titles were earlier narrated by Stephen Fry and Jim Dale, who won the Grammy Award for his audio performance in 2008. Instead of a single narration, the upcoming project will consist of actors lending their voices to the myriad characters of the Wizarding World of Harry Potter.

The audiobooks, set to be created in collaboration with Pottermore Publishing, will have a completely original score and sound design as compared to the soundtrack in the films created by John Williams, Patrick Doyle, Nicholas Hooper and Alexandre Desplat.

“Together with Pottermore Publishing, best-in-class producers, and over one hundred actors, we will introduce a groundbreaking new soundscape for the Wizarding World, as well as performances that will inspire our listeners’ imaginations and redefine these quintessential characters for a new generation,” Audible CEO Bob Carrigan said in a statement.

The complete Harry Potter audiobook collection on Audible includes the seven titles narrated by Dale. It also consists of audiobook versions of the Hogwarts Library collection — The Tales of Beedle the Bard narrated by Jude Law, Harry Potter: A History of Magic narrated by Natalie Dormer,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them narrated by Eddie Redmayne and Quidditch Through the Ages narrated by Andrew Lincoln.
